    I love the smoothness of the Moen Eva line and have done all my bathrooms with the oil rubbed bronze. In the past we have had a problem or two with the black installation pieces but Moen has been very accommodating in sending replacement pieces. Dont tighten them down too much or the ends will not snap on properly. We had to make some adaptions for mounting onto wood. Weve never had a bent bar.

    From reading the other reviews, it seems that many of the problems are due to the included anchor (standard expanding metal molly bolt type). Im not a fan of these, because once expanded you basically have to drive them through the wall to remove them. Instead of using these anchors, I did myself a favor: I removed the included anchors from the plastic mount and instead used threaded drywall anchors (EZ Ancor 75lb rating, look like big plastic screws, the top flange is exactly the same size as the recess in the mount, and the screws that come with them fit the hole in the mount perfectly). With these installed in the wall, the mounts screw down nice and tight - solid, absolutely no wiggle or play, no worrying about how many turns you need, and I can unscrew these if I ever want to remove them from the wall in the future. (Even though you technically dont have to, I predrilled holes for the anchors to keep them neat.) Note: the 75lb rating plastic anchor splits when the mounting screw is driven in completely. The EZ Ancor line also includes a metal anchor that, like the older plastic model, doesnt split, and is rated at only 45 lbs. Although better than the molly bolts, the non-splitting threaded anchors dont hold nearly as solidly as the splitting ones.) I had mixed results with the clicking of the ends to the mounts: with the 24-inch models, all audibly (but quietly) clicked. The 18-inch models did not (or didnt click loudly enough for me to hear them - the tabs arent all that big). However, all are very snug fitting, and Im pretty confident that theyll hold up. Make sure that you triple-check your measurements between centers (18 rack has 18 centers, 24 rack has 24 centers) and that you have the tabs on the mounts on the correct side to match the holes in the end pieces. Overall, a pretty solid design (much better than those cheap setscrew, sheetmetal mount racks that they replaced), and they match the Eva faucets as well.

    The towel bar looks very nice in our bathroom. However, the mounting bracket has one anchor point in the center of the bracket. I created a second anchor point using a dry wall anchor to fasten the bracket through one of the additional holes near the edge of the bracket. The old way of attaching towel bars, etc. using two toggle screws worked much better.
